深入解析V2Ray协议:工作原理与应用

引言

在当今信息技术高速发展的时代,网络安全与隐私保护愈发受到关注。随着VPN技术的广泛应用,各类网络代理工具层出不穷,其中以V2Ray协议尤为突出。本文将全面解析V2Ray协议的工作原理、特性以及应用场景。

什么是V2Ray协议?

V2Ray是一个功能强大的网络代理工具,旨在帮助用户实现匿名上网和突破网络限制。V2Ray不仅支持多种代理协议(如VMess、Shadowsocks等),还具有灵活的配置和高效的传输能力。

V2Ray的工作原理

V2Ray协议的工作原理主要涉及以下几个方面:

  1. 传输层:V2Ray支持多种传输协议,包括TCP、UDP、WebSocket等,确保在不同网络环境下的高效传输。
  2. 加密技术:通过多层加密和混淆,V2Ray能够有效防止流量被检测和阻断,提升用户的安全性和匿名性。
  3. 路由功能:V2Ray的路由系统可以根据用户的需求,选择最优的路径进行数据传输,从而提高访问速度和稳定性。

V2Ray的主要特性

V2Ray的功能与特性使其成为网络代理工具中的佼佼者,主要包括:

  • 多种协议支持:V2Ray不仅支持VMess协议,还兼容Shadowsocks、Socks、HTTP等多种协议。
  • 动态端口:可以在不干扰使用的情况下,动态更改端口,增加安全性。
  • 复杂的路由配置:允许用户自定义路由规则,方便管理不同网络请求。
  • 多平台支持:V2Ray可以在多种操作系统上运行,包括Windows、Linux、macOS等。

V2Ray的应用场景

V2Ray协议可以广泛应用于以下几个场景:

  • 翻墙:突破地域限制,访问被屏蔽的网站和内容。
  • 匿名上网:保护用户的隐私信息,防止被追踪。
  • 安全传输:在公共网络环境下,保障数据传输的安全性。

如何搭建V2Ray服务?

步骤一:安装V2Ray

  1. 下载V2Ray客户端:前往V2Ray的官方GitHub页面下载相应的版本。
  2. 根据操作系统进行安装:
    • 对于Windows,直接运行安装程序。
    • 对于Linux,使用命令行进行安装。

步骤二:配置V2Ray

  1. 找到并编辑V2Ray的配置文件(通常为config.json)。
  2. 根据自己的需求设置入站和出站协议,配置路由规则。

步骤三:启动V2Ray

  1. 在命令行中输入v2ray run命令启动服务。

常见问题解答(FAQ)

V2Ray协议和Shadowsocks有什么区别?

V2RayShadowsocks都是网络代理工具,但V2Ray提供了更为强大的路由和多协议支持功能。Shadowsocks主要依赖于一个简单的代理模式,而V2Ray可以通过复杂的配置实现更加灵活的网络策略。

如何选择合适的V2Ray服务器?

选择合适的V2Ray服务器时,用户可以考虑以下几个因素:

  • 延迟和速度:选择距离较近的服务器,以获得更低的延迟和更快的速度。
  • 服务器稳定性:确保服务器的稳定性和可用性,以避免频繁掉线。
  • 安全性:选择具有良好声誉的服务提供商,确保数据的安全传输。

V2Ray的使用安全吗?

V2Ray协议通过多层加密和混淆技术,能够有效保护用户的隐私安全。然而,用户仍需选择可信的服务器和服务提供商,以避免数据泄露的风险。

V2Ray是否适用于手机端?

是的,V2Ray支持多种移动平台,用户可以通过相应的V2Ray客户端在手机上实现匿名上网和网络加速。

结论

V2Ray协议因其灵活性、扩展性以及强大的功能而受到广泛关注。无论是个人用户还是企业用户,V2Ray都能提供良好的解决方案,以应对网络环境中的挑战。希望通过本文的介绍,您能更好地理解和使用V2Ray协议,保护您的网络安全与隐私。

正文完